Khadean is a modern, creative name likely derived by combining elements that suggest nobility and wisdom. It echoes sounds found in names of Arabic and African origin, where 'Khad' can mean 'to gather' or 'noble,' and 'ean' suggests grace or femininity. Though not rooted in ancient etymology, Khadean embodies a sense of strength and leadership in a fresh, contemporary style.
